教妹学Java:代码初始化块,让我先走一步

Posted 沉默王二

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了教妹学Java:代码初始化块,让我先走一步相关的知识,希望对你有一定的参考价值。

代码初始快

“哥,今天我们要学习的内容是‘代码初始化块’,对吧?”看来三妹已经提前预习了我上次留给她的作业。

“是的,三妹。代码初始化块用于初始化一些成员变量。 ”我面带着朴实无华的微笑回答着她,“对象在创建的时候会执行代码初始化块。”

“可以直接通过‘=’操作符对成员变量进行初始化,但通过代码初始化块可以做更多的事情,比如说打印出成员变量初始化后的值。”

“三妹,来看下面的代码,我们可以直接通过 = 操作符对成员变量进行初始化。”

class Bike{
     
    int speed=100;  
}  

“哥,那为什么还需要代码初始化块呢?”三妹眨了眨眼睛,不解地问。

“我们可以通过代码初始化块执行一个更复杂的操作,比如为集合填充值。来看下面这段代码。”

public class

以上是关于教妹学Java:代码初始化块,让我先走一步的主要内容,如果未能解决你的问题,请参考以下文章

教妹学 Java:try-with-resouces

教妹学 Java:字符串拼接

教妹学Java:Java 运算符一锅炖

教妹学 Java:深入理解 Java 反射

教妹学Java:学妹必须学会的static 关键字

教妹学Java:构造方法,对象初始化的必经之路